Output b5aed6016af207652a361317adf9674d1678ca12b6e794c95eb27fa17f125999:2

value
4521614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d03796083c81f2860f29be88bbd7e326825ec80 OP_EQUALVERIFY OP_CHECKSIG
address
1571a27BjzpcTPi3aqq1e44RuyV2PsAtZQ
transaction
b5aed6016af207652a361317adf9674d1678ca12b6e794c95eb27fa17f125999
confirmations
268290
spent
true